EPL roundup: Bottom trio look doomed, 3 red cards in Palace-Brighton fracas


Wolves successfully sealed their survival and left Ipswich on the point of relegation with a 2-1 win at Portman Street.

Vitor Pereira’s aspect trailed to Liam Delap’s Sixteenth-minute purpose because the striker swept in Dara O’Shea’s knockdown.

However Pablo Sarabia drilled into the underside nook to haul Wolves degree within the 72nd minute, earlier than Jorgen Strand Larsen prodded residence on 84 minutes for his fourth purpose in his final three video games.

Fourth-bottom Wolves at the moment are 12 factors away from third-bottom Ipswich with simply seven video games left, leaving Kieran McKenna’s aspect virtually sure to return to the Championship after only one season.

Wolves’ victory additionally means backside of the desk Southampton shall be relegated in the event that they lose at Tottenham on Sunday.

Crystal Palace beat Brighton 2-1 regardless of ending with 9 males in a bruising battle that includes three pink playing cards at Selhurst Park.

FA Cup semi-finalists Palace went forward due to Jean-Philippe Mateta’s third minute roller, earlier than Danny Welbeck’s close-range effort within the thirty first minute dragged Brighton degree.

Daniel Munoz blasted Palace’s winner within the fifty fifth minute, however the Eagles needed to dig deep for the win.

Palace striker Eddie Nketiah was despatched off for 2 bookings within the area of 9 minutes, then team-mate Marc Guehi was dismissed for selecting up a second yellow card within the ninetieth minute.

In a frantic finale, Brighton’s Jan Paul van Hecke was proven a pink card for his foul on Daichi Kamada.

Evanilson scored twice as Bournemouth drew 2-2 with West Ham on the London Stadium.

The Brazilian opened the scoring within the thirty eighth minute and bagged Bournemouth’s equaliser with 11 minutes left after Niclas Fullkrug and Jarrod Bowen had put West Ham forward.

Aston Villa host third-placed Nottingham Forest in Saturday’s late recreation, with each groups pushing to safe qualification for subsequent season’s Champions League.
